Starting with this release, the `events` and `audit_log` tables in Marrowgate are partitioned by calendar month rather than by quarter. New installations pick this up automatically; upgraded instances keep their existing quarterly partitions until the next maintenance window, when the repartitioning job runs. Support should expect questions about temporarily elevated disk usage during that window — this is normal and self-resolving. The new defaults applied by the repartitioning job are listed below.

config for tagep-yajef:
ulawyn:
  log_level: error
  metrics_host: metrics.ulawyn.lumiclabs.internal
  pin: 0564
  pool_size: 32

## Support

All fonts in `vendor/fonts/` are pinned by checksum and mirrored internally at Hartgrove. No runtime fetches. License texts live alongside each family. Updates go through the Typeforge review script; manual edits are rejected in CI. Report checksum mismatches or license concerns to the packaging team at the address below.

escalation mailbox, hadug-bajog: sormir@norvalabs.internal

Meeting notes — Infra sync, Thursday. Branch office at Marlow Point still running the failed Veridon unit on a loaner chassis. Replacement server (Oxbridge R4, pre-imaged by the Calverton bench team) is boxed and signed off. Records team to log serial transfer once delivery confirms. Downtime window agreed with branch lead Petra Osmun: Saturday 06:00–09:00. Old unit returns for secure disposal the same run. No remote handling — physical swap only. The courier hand-over must follow the confidential instruction below.

handover note for hahaf-kagap: the julok istmir courier leaves the julmir ralix briius fenmir istael druiel kelax gilath ledger at gate 3239 under passcode 889722

Hey — handing off the bounce processor (Sablequill) before I'm out next week. It's been stable, but the soft-bounce retry queue backs up when Mailrose's sandbox throttles us, usually Monday mornings. If the dead-letter count climbs past a few hundred, just drain it with the replay script; don't purge. Hard bounces auto-suppress, so no action there. Alerts route to the on-call channel as usual. The processor's current config, for reference, is:

service settings:
[casax]
port = 6379
team = rusir
host = casax.zemvarhq.corp
region = outer-4
access_code = ac_9808ce
timeout_ms = 1500